BrusselsNew warning from the European Commission to Spain over the legislation the Spanish government used to block the failed public takeover bid (OPA) launched by BBVA against Sabadell. Brussels has sent a new letter to the State reminding it, as it already warned last summer, that it is not complying with European regulations on banking acquisitions, mergers, and spin-offs. This is Brussels’ prior warning before what is known as a reasoned opinion, which, if not heeded, will lead to the case being brought before the European justice system.
